Utopai Studios Fully Integrates Utopai East Following Rapid Expansion Across Korea and Japan

September 1, 2026 by TVA Editor

Hyun Park

Utopai Studios has announced the unification of its Asia-Pacific business, completing the integration of Utopai East into Utopai Studios and naming veteran international media executive Hyun Park President of Utopai Studios APAC region.

The move brings the company’s Korea-based production operation, Japan development business, regional partnerships and pipeline of more than 18 film and television projects into a single global studio structure. Park will oversee development, production, partnerships and expansion across the Asia-Pacific region while continuing to lead IP development across Utopai Studios.

Utopai Studios has approximately 25 film and television projects in development and production, with its first titles entering production in 2026 and releases planned for 2027. The integration connects creators in Korea and Japan directly with the company’s global development, production and technology teams.

Created in November 2025 as a joint venture between Utopai Studios and Stock Farm Road, Utopai East moved from launch to operating scale in ten months. Under founding CEO Kevin Chong, the business established a permanent production base in Korea, built a development operation in Japan, expanded its regional AI-production capabilities and formed relationships across the live-action and anime industries. Chong now serves as COO of Utopai Studios.

The venture was created to develop East Asian intellectual property for global audiences, building on the international popularity of Korean films and television, the global reach of Japanese anime and renewed global interest in Japanese live-action entertainment.

South Korea’s content exports reached a record $14.9 billion in 2025, according to preliminary government figures. Japan’s anime market reached a record ¥3.84 trillion in 2024, with more than half of its revenue coming from overseas. Netflix and Amazon are also expanding their investments in Japanese live-action and animated content for global audiences.

“Utopai East proved that our strategy in Asia could move quickly from ambition to execution,” said Cecilia Shen, CEO and Co-Founder of Utopai Studios. “Kevin led the business from launch through integration, and Hyun helped build the creative and production engine at its center. Hyun brings a rare combination of creative judgment, local market knowledge and global experience, making him the right leader to take Utopai Studios APAC into its next phase.”

A major milestone in that expansion was Utopai East’s February 2026 acquisition of Alquimista Media, the Seoul-based production company founded by Park. The acquisition established Utopai East’s production base in Korea and added more than 15 scripted film and television projects to its pipeline.

Alquimista Media’s recent work includes its association with Bedford Park, with Park serving as an executive producer. The film premiered at the 2026 Sundance Film Festival, received the U.S. Dramatic Special Jury Award for Debut Feature and was acquired by Sony Pictures Classics.

Park has more than two decades of experience across Asia, Europe and the Americas. His previous roles include Head of the Global Division at CJ ENM’s Studio Dragon, co-Head of Warner Bros. Korea and co-founder of the U.S.-based streaming platform DramaFever.

In Japan, Utopai East built a dedicated development team focused on originating and adapting Japanese intellectual property for global audiences. The team has been developing projects with Japanese creators, producers and studios while establishing collaborations across the country’s live-action and anime industries.

The regional slate includes Half Moon, an upcoming German-Korean live-action feature from writer-director Hyo-joo Yang. Utopai Studios is presenting, co-producing and investing in the film alongside Germany’s In Good Company and Korea’s Paper Barn. Principal photography will begin in Germany the first week of September, with Utopai Studios’ technology supporting select visual elements while the production remains filmmaker-led.

“Korea and Japan will play an increasingly important role in the global entertainment economy,” said Park. “Our opportunity is to connect the region’s creators and intellectual property with international production resources while applying technology in ways that expand what filmmakers can achieve. We have built the foundation; the next phase is turning it into an enduring platform for Asian stories to reach audiences worldwide.”
